Benefits of using natural or eco-friendly cleaning products

Switching to natural or eco-friendly cleaning products can have a multitude of benefits when it comes to the effectiveness of cleaning. Not only are these products safer for the environment and our health, but they can also be just as effective, if not more so, than traditional chemical-laden cleaners.


One of the main advantages of using natural cleaning products is that they are often made from plant-based ingredients that are non-toxic and biodegradable. This means that they won't leave behind harmful residues that can linger in your home or impact the environment. In contrast, many conventional cleaners contain harsh chemicals that can be irritating to the skin and respiratory system, not to mention damaging to aquatic life when washed down the drain.


Furthermore, natural cleaning products are just as capable of tackling tough messes and stains as their chemical counterparts. Ingredients like vinegar, baking soda, lemon juice, and essential oils have powerful cleaning properties that can effectively remove dirt, grime, and odors without the need for harsh chemicals. In fact, many people find that natural cleaners work even better than conventional ones in some cases.


In addition to being effective at cleaning, natural products also tend to be more versatile and cost-effective. Many common household items like vinegar and baking soda can be used for a variety of cleaning tasks throughout your home. This eliminates the need for multiple specialized cleaners and reduces clutter under your sink. And since these ingredients are often inexpensive and readily available, making your own natural cleaning solutions can save you money in the long run.


Overall, making the switch to natural or eco-friendly cleaning products is a smart choice for both your health and the planet. By opting for safer alternatives that are just as effective at getting your home sparkling clean, you can enjoy a cleaner living space without compromising on performance or sustainability.

Comparison of effectiveness between chemical-based and natural cleaning products

When it comes to cleaning products, there are generally two main categories: chemical-based and natural. Each type has its own set of advantages and disadvantages, especially when it comes to their effectiveness in cleaning.


Chemical-based cleaning products often contain strong ingredients that are specifically designed to break down dirt and grime. These chemicals can be very effective at removing tough stains and killing bacteria and germs. However, they can also be harsh on the environment and potentially harmful to human health if not used properly.


On the other hand, natural cleaning products are made from plant-based or biodegradable ingredients that are gentler on both surfaces and the environment. While they may not always be as powerful as their chemical counterparts, natural cleaners can still effectively clean most surfaces while being safer for use around children and pets.


In terms of effectiveness, both types of cleaning products have their strengths. Chemical-based cleaners are usually more effective at cutting through grease and grime quickly, making them ideal for heavy-duty cleaning tasks. Natural cleaners may require a bit more elbow grease to achieve the same level of cleanliness, but they offer a safer alternative for everyday use.


Ultimately, the choice between chemical-based and natural cleaning products comes down to personal preference and priorities. If you prioritize effectiveness above all else, chemical-based cleaners may be the way to go. However, if you value safety and sustainability, natural cleaners could be a better option for your household. Whichever type you choose, always remember to follow instructions carefully and use proper safety precautions when handling any cleaning product.

Tips for incorporating green cleaning practices into daily routines

Incorporating green cleaning practices into your daily routine is not only beneficial for the environment, but it can also be more effective in keeping your living spaces clean and healthy. By using natural, eco-friendly cleaning products, you can avoid harmful chemicals that can be found in conventional cleaners.


One tip for incorporating green cleaning practices into your daily routine is to make your own cleaning solutions using simple ingredients like vinegar, baking soda, and essential oils. These natural products are just as effective at cleaning and disinfecting surfaces as their chemical counterparts, without the negative impact on the environment.


Another tip is to reduce waste by using reusable cleaning cloths and sponges instead of disposable ones. This not only helps to cut down on waste, but it can also save you money in the long run.


Additionally, consider investing in energy-efficient appliances and using them efficiently to reduce your overall energy consumption. For example, running full loads of laundry and dishes can help conserve water and energy.


By making small changes to your daily cleaning routine, you can make a big impact on the effectiveness of your cleaning efforts while also reducing your environmental footprint. Incorporating green cleaning practices into your daily routine is a simple way to promote a healthier home and planet for future generations.
